Output 30140368620ec489e2768b42fcbfe02589fea0ca8ad6ba76797f4aa4c273be6a:11

value
326408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b9006c18e7d1691464e66201b9346661dcfde98 OP_EQUAL
address
3FsZCQXt4iQRBP9bguuo4QxSFRZ418bQ32
transaction
30140368620ec489e2768b42fcbfe02589fea0ca8ad6ba76797f4aa4c273be6a
confirmations
169156
spent
true